Join Brazelton Touchpoints Center on October 19 for “Honoring Each Person’s Experience to Support Mental Health” to learn how to apply reflective practice and perspective-taking to your virtual work with children and families.
When working with families, especially within today’s current crises, it is important that everyone’s experience of a situation is heard and understood. This requires reflecting on all points of view: one’s own, the child’s, and that of their family members. In this webinar, participants will learn how to adapt and apply reflective practice and perspective-taking to their virtual work with children and families.
This session is best suited for professionals who work with families of young children, including early care educators, family child care providers, mental health consultants, home visitors, pediatricians, early interventionists, and more.
